
Plastic bottles are a common household item, but disposing of them correctly can be confusing due to varying recycling guidelines across different regions. Generally, plastic bottles are made from materials like PET (polyethylene terephthalate) or HDPE (high-density polyethylene), which are widely recyclable. In most areas, these bottles should be placed in the recycling bin, often marked with a specific symbol or color, such as blue or green. However, it’s important to rinse the bottles to remove any residue and remove lids or caps, as these may need to be disposed of separately. Always check local recycling guidelines, as some areas may have specific rules or restrictions. Proper disposal ensures plastic bottles are recycled efficiently, reducing environmental impact and promoting sustainability.

Recycling Bin Basics: Identify correct bin for plastic bottles in your local recycling program
Plastic bottles are a common household item, but their disposal can vary widely depending on your location. The first step to recycling them correctly is understanding your local recycling program’s guidelines. Most programs accept plastic bottles made from PET (polyethylene terephthalate, labeled as #1) and HDPE (high-density polyethylene, labeled as #2), which are typically used for water, soda, and milk containers. However, not all programs handle these materials the same way. Some require bottles to be rinsed and caps removed, while others may accept them as-is. Check your local waste management website or contact them directly to confirm the specifics, as these details can significantly impact whether your bottles are recycled or sent to a landfill.
Once you’ve identified the accepted materials, the next step is locating the correct bin. In many areas, plastic bottles go into the commingled recycling bin, often marked with symbols for plastics, glass, and metals. However, some programs use a single-stream system where all recyclables are placed in one bin, while others may require plastics to be separated. For instance, in certain cities, plastic bottles must be placed in a dedicated plastics-only bin to avoid contamination. Misplacing bottles in the wrong bin can render them unrecyclable, so it’s crucial to follow local instructions precisely.
Contamination is a major issue in plastic bottle recycling, often caused by residual liquids or non-recyclable materials like straws or lids. To ensure your bottles are processed correctly, rinse them with a small amount of water (about 1-2 tablespoons) to remove any residue. Remove caps, as they are often made from different plastics and may need to be disposed of separately. Flattening bottles can save space in your bin and make collection more efficient, but avoid crushing them completely, as this can interfere with sorting machinery.

Bottle Preparation: Rinse bottles, remove caps, and flatten to save space
Plastic bottles, a ubiquitous byproduct of modern life, often end up in recycling bins, but their journey to a second life begins long before they reach the curb. Proper preparation is key to ensuring these bottles are recycled efficiently. Start by rinsing them with a quick splash of water to remove any residual liquids or food particles. This simple step prevents contamination and reduces the risk of attracting pests during storage or transport. A clean bottle is a recyclable one, and this minimal effort can significantly impact the recycling process.
Caps, often made from a different type of plastic than the bottle, should be removed and disposed of separately. While some recycling programs accept caps, many do not, and leaving them on can cause issues during sorting. Flattening bottles is another practical step that saves space in your recycling bin and makes collection more efficient. Step on the bottle firmly to compress it, but avoid crushing it completely, as this can make it harder for recycling machinery to process. These small actions collectively streamline the recycling process, ensuring more plastic bottles are successfully repurposed.
Consider the environmental benefits of these preparatory steps. Rinsing bottles reduces the likelihood of entire batches being rejected due to contamination, while removing caps prevents them from jamming sorting machines. Flattening bottles not only conserves space but also reduces the frequency of recycling pickups, cutting down on fuel consumption and emissions. By investing a few seconds in preparing each bottle, you contribute to a more sustainable recycling system that maximizes resource recovery.

Non-Recyclable Plastics: Avoid putting non-recyclable plastics like Styrofoam in recycling bins
Styrofoam, a lightweight and insulating material, is a common culprit in recycling contamination. Despite its prevalence in packaging, it’s not recyclable in most curbside programs. Its low density makes it difficult to process economically, and its polystyrene composition breaks into small, non-recyclable pieces during sorting. These fragments often end up in landfills or, worse, in natural ecosystems, where they persist for hundreds of years. When placed in recycling bins, Styrofoam can jam machinery, increase sorting costs, and devalue other recyclables. The takeaway? Always check local guidelines, but generally, Styrofoam belongs in the trash—or better yet, avoided altogether.

Comparative: Unlike plastic bottles, which are widely recyclable in most regions, Styrofoam lacks a standardized recycling process. While bottles are made from PET (polyethylene terephthalate), a material easily melted and reformed, Styrofoam’s polystyrene structure is chemically and logistically challenging to recycle. This disparity highlights the importance of material selection in product design. Manufacturers should prioritize recyclability, and consumers should favor products packaged in materials like glass, aluminum, or PET, which have established recycling streams. Local Guidelines: Check city/county rules for specific plastic bottle recycling instructions
Plastic bottle recycling isn’t one-size-fits-all. While general rules suggest rinsing bottles and removing caps, local guidelines dictate the specifics. For instance, some cities accept only certain resin codes (like #1 or #2), while others require caps to be discarded separately. Even the bin color or collection method can vary—curbside pickup, drop-off centers, or specialized recycling events. Ignoring these details risks contamination, which can derail entire recycling batches. Always consult your city or county’s waste management website or call their hotline to ensure compliance.
Consider the case of San Francisco versus Houston. In San Francisco, plastic bottles go into the blue bin, caps attached, as part of their comprehensive recycling program. Houston, however, requires caps to be removed and discarded, as they’re often made of different plastics. Such discrepancies highlight why local rules matter. A quick online search or a glance at your recycling guide (often mailed annually) can save time and reduce errors. Pro tip: Set a reminder to check for updates, as guidelines can change annually.
For those in rural or suburban areas, the rules may be even more specific. Some counties have limited recycling facilities and only accept bottles during certain months or at designated locations. Others may charge fees for drop-off services. For example, in parts of Wisconsin, residents must crush bottles to save space in collection bins. In contrast, Arizona’s Maricopa County encourages whole bottles to maintain sorting efficiency. These nuances underscore the importance of local research—what works in one place may not apply elsewhere.

Alternative Disposal: Consider reuse or upcycling if recycling isn’t an option
Plastic bottles often end up in the recycling bin, but what if recycling isn’t feasible? Contamination, lack of local facilities, or improper sorting can render them unrecyclable. Before tossing them into the trash, consider reuse or upcycling as viable alternatives. These methods extend the life of the material, reduce waste, and foster creativity. For instance, a clean plastic bottle can become a makeshift watering can, a storage container for small items, or even a DIY bird feeder. The key is to assess the bottle’s condition and explore practical second-life uses before discarding it.
Upcycling takes reuse a step further by transforming plastic bottles into something entirely new. With basic tools and creativity, bottles can be cut, painted, or combined to create functional or decorative items. For example, cutting the top off a soda bottle and inverting it creates a self-watering planter for small herbs or succulents. Larger bottles can be fashioned into vertical garden systems, reducing the need for additional materials. Online tutorials abound with ideas, from desk organizers to outdoor lighting, proving that upcycling is accessible to all skill levels. The environmental benefit lies in reducing demand for new products while diverting waste from landfills.
For those with limited time or crafting interest, reuse remains a simpler yet impactful option. Plastic bottles are ideal for storing pantry staples like rice or beans, provided they are thoroughly cleaned and dried. They can also serve as travel containers for toiletries, though it’s crucial to avoid using them for hot liquids or food storage if the plastic isn’t food-grade. Schools and community centers often accept donations of clean bottles for art projects, offering another avenue for reuse. The goal is to maximize utility before considering disposal, aligning with the principles of a circular economy.
